Does staying in the garden wing close the gap of convince of this hotel. I've walked the walkway and its 10mns to front door of Contemp and then the walk to your room, then the walk to go to food court and pool. I don't know it seems u might be walking more then your saving with "the monorail resort." Any opinions?
 
I've stayed in the wing twice and the tower once. I never felt like it was inconvenient to walk to the wing (1 less elevator ride, especially when coming from the pool or the bus stop).

Does it take a bit longer to refill your mug? Sure, but we rarely use them anyway.

It was still a shorter walk than getting from the monorail platform at the GF to Conch Key, for example.

It is also a covered walk which is great during a FL downpour.
 
I really love the garden wing...it is SO LESS chaotic than the tower. I never noticed a huge amount of "time" involved walking around this resort, whatever the reason/purpose. Or maybe I'm just a fast walker.:lmao:
 
We just returned from the CR - Garden View Wing. It was lovely. We were able to watch Wishes from our room, my train loving son had a view of the monorail line, AND we had a nice view of the Tower, BLT, the pool and beach.

Being 30 weeks pregnant, I did find the walking to be more than I expected, but as the week carried on, I got used to it. We ate breakfast at Contempo Cafe every morning with the exception of our ADR for Chef Mickey's one morning. We weren't on the meal plan so no need to fill mugs.

If we book again, I will definitely book a Garden Wing.

When we stayed at the Contemporary, I did find the Garden Wing to be a pain. We stayed there before the mugs were part of the dining plan, so I didn't buy one because I knew I would walk over there just to get some soda. We were in the VERY back of the wing near the lake. If we were closer to the tower I might have not minded so much. DH said we were not staying there again unless we could afford the Tower.
